Ethan, Jeff, and I headed to Issaquah to go to the Cougar Mountain Zoo. We had never been before so we decided to check it out and were pretty surprised. The zoo is pretty small but once you get past the gate there is very cool stuff to see. When you first go through the gate you are welcomed by the mountain lions, reindeer, and two large tigers. You could get pretty close to the animals and you could feed the reindeer. I would definitely recommend visiting the zoo around Christmas time since it looked like they had a lot of themed items around the reindeer.

Past the tigers was an area that had deer, llamas, wallaby’s, and Emu’s that you could feed. The deer and the llama’s ate right out of Ethan’s hand. They also brought out the baby tigers to play while we were there as well that was a treat to see. Further down were the Parrots that were really funny to watch. Many of them could talk as well and there was one that liked to say hello, peek a boo, and bye to us.

Jeff and I had a gift certificate given to us by one of his co-workers a while back for a hot air balloon ride that we were dying to use. It was with Aerial Balloon in Snohomish and we had made several attempts to go up in the air but they had all previously been cancelled because of weather.

We woke up at the crack of dawn and met up at the Aerial Balloon at 6 AM for our sunset flight. Luckily the wind was not that bad and the weather was cooperating so we were able to go up this time. There actually really was not any wind so we went up in the air and stayed there. We did go up about 5000 ft and into the clouds which was really cool and when you got up that high you could feel the air change. Once we came down again we caught a little wind and floated over the river right above the trees. When we landed we actually didn’t make it to where the pilot was shooting towards and basically landed in this guys back yard area. It was a pretty thrilling landing because when we came down we barely missed taking out his satalite dish and hitting his roof but we made it safely to the ground.
